From a property perspective, the most significant aspect of the new Park is that on 1 April the South Downs National Park Authority (SDNPA) has become the sole planning authority for the area. South Downs Property sought the views of Andrew Shaxson, Chair of the Planning Committee. Andrew Shaxson has a lifelong connection with the South Downs. In 1932 his grandfather bought the family farm in Elsted where Andrew himself has farmed, although the land is now managed by his cousin. He lists his hobbies as walking (he has walked round Britain), gardening and local history. His local knowledge of planning and local issues has been cemented by serving on the South Downs Conservation Board and the South Downs Joint Committee for 8 years, nearly 12 years on Chichester District Council, and 20 years on his local parish council. Andrew became Planning Committee Chair of the SDNPA last June and has no illusions about the responsibilities of the job. He knows that there are some public concerns about the SDNPA’s future planning role. He has said that “community involvement in the planning process is vital to ensure that planning policies are the right ones in this very special place. Planning continues to be a focus for many people across the National Park, and we want to ensure that we get the balance right. “A demanding task will be to work with the 1,600 planning policies of the 15 local authorities within the National Park, before we produce our own Local Development Framework in about three years time, ” Andrew Shaxson explains. “The Park was formerly two Areas of Outstanding Natural Beauty (AONB) and the SDNPA’s remit is to ‘take lead responsibility for keeping it a special place’.” The planning committee has 10 members, all with planning experience – including a planning barrister. “Having served in local authorities, a number of us as planning portfolio holders, we have a vision of our work for the SDNPA, which will have similarities to our existing experiences. We know that the public has concerns, but we are wise to lobbying and we must avoid being bowed by public pressure – and act in the best interests of the Park and its inhabitants. “The main planning principle for development within the National Park is that it will be demand-led rather than marketled. I don’t think we will be unnecessarily restrictive, and there will be some open-market housing – but not as much as if the National Park had not been created. “It is important to remember that the second ‘purpose’ of the Park is to promote the understanding and enjoyment of the area. being passed, if it doesn’t conflict with the conservation of the area. That said, we won’t pass every leisure scheme. “There are some big applications in the pipeline – in Petersfield, Liss, and Lewes; the Horncroft Sand Quarry near Fittleworth, and the King Edward VII hospital site. They will be a challenge we will look forward to resolving.” The SDNPA is responsible to DEFRA (the Department of the Environment, Food and Rural Affairs), who are their paymasters. “We don’t take anything from the local taxpayer,” Andrew Shaxson points out, “but we can access funds from sources such as European funding and by other means which are not available to the local authorities.” The committee will deal with the ‘Significant’ planning applications in the National Park. These are expected to total between 120 and 150 from the 3,500 to 4,000 planning applications which they are likely to receive every year – this makes it the eighth biggest planning authority in England in terms of workload. The local authorities will remain the first port of call on planning matters. The SDNPA is employing four link officers who will have a crucial role in the planning process. The areas they cover are Hampshire (Winchester City Council, Hampshire County Council and East Hampshire District Council); Chichester District Council (including the east of West Sussex County Council); the rest of West Sussex; and East Sussex (including Brighton and Hove). The link officers will scrutinize all relevant planning applications for the SDNPA. In the interim year since April 2010, the SDNPA has worked closely with the local authorities developing working arrangements. Andrew sums up: “It is important that we ensure the needs of those who live, visit and work in the National Park are met, while we protect the area for the future.” SDNPA, 0300 303 1053 www.southdowns.gov.uk
